Select Page

Milan based CR&S Motorcycles have a good name for themselves when it comes to making some real powerful pieces that can make a strong statement. Latest to roll off their lines is the DUU, a fully customizable muscle machine that has a giant V-twin engine powering it up. They’ve got quite a list of options to go with the DUU, making it viable for plenty of potential customers.

Via Flylyf

Pin It on Pinterest